What is PDF Encryptor?

PDF encrypt tool adds AES-256 password protection to any PDF document so only authorized recipients can open it. It runs entirely in the browser, applying industry-standard encryption without ever transmitting your file to a cloud service. Businesses, lawyers, and individuals use PDF encryption to protect confidential reports, personal data, and proprietary information.

Pro Tip

Choose a password with at least 12 characters mixing letters, numbers, and symbols — AES-256 encryption is only as strong as the password you choose. Store the password in a password manager immediately after encrypting, because this tool cannot recover or crack an open password you forget.
